1. Queen of Hill Stations & Colonial History

Nestled at an altitude of 2,240 metres in the Nilgiri Hills of Tamil Nadu, Ooty (officially Udhagamandalam) is celebrated as the "Queen of Hill Stations". Established as a summer capital by John Sullivan in 1819 for the Madras Presidency, Ooty is famous for the **UNESCO World Heritage Nilgiri Mountain Railway (Steam Toy Train)**, **Doddabetta Peak (2,637 m)**, **Government Botanical Gardens (est. 1848)**, **Pykara Lake**, and indigenous **Toda tribal settlements**.

πŸš‚ UNESCO World Heritage Mountain Steam Railway

Built by the British in 1908, the 46-km Nilgiri Mountain Railway features the steepest rack-and-pinion track system in Asia, carrying passengers across 208 curves, 16 tunnels, and 250 bridges from Mettupalayam to Ooty via Coonoor.

4. Nilgiri Mountain Railway (UNESCO World Heritage)

Decl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 2005, the **Nilgiri Mountain Railway (NMR)** operates X-Class steam locomotives using a specialized Abt rack-and-pinion system to climb steep mountain grades. 5. Doddabetta Peak (2,637 M) & Telescope House

Located 10 km from Ooty town at an elevation of **2,637 metres (8,652 ft)**, **Doddabetta** is the highest peak in Tamil Nadu.

The Tamil Nadu Tourism Development Corporation (TTDC) maintains an octagonal Telescope House providing clear views of Chamundi Hills in Mysore and the Nilgiri plateau.

6. Government Botanical Gardens & Rose Garden

Established in 1848 by William Graham McIvor, the **Government Botanical Garden** is laid out in six terraced sections: Lower Garden, New Garden, Italian Garden, Conservatory, Fountain Terrace, and Nurseries.

7. Pykara Waterfalls, Lake Boating & Pine Forest

Situated 21 km from Ooty on the Mysore Road, **Pykara** features a sacred river, two cascading waterfalls, motorboat rides on Pykara Lake, and dense pine tree shooting spots. 9. Coimbatore & Mysore Highway Transport Roster

Route Segment Distance Transit Time Transport Mode
Coimbatore Airport (CJB) β†’ Ooty Town 88 KM 3 hours NH181 Highway drive via Mettupalayam & Coonoor ghat (36 hairpin bends)
Mysore β†’ Ooty 125 KM 3.5 hours NH766 Highway drive through Bandipur & Mudumalai Tiger Reserve
Mettupalayam Railway Station β†’ Ooty Station 46 KM 4.8 hours UNESCO Nilgiri Mountain Railway Toy Train
Ooty Town β†’ Pykara Lake / Avalanche Lake 21 KM / 28 KM 45 / 60 minutes Local Taxi Union Cabs
